Overview Of Robotic Process Automation Updates

Robotic Process Automation (RPA) continues to evolve, responding to the increasing demand for operational efficiency. Recent updates focus on enhanced integration capabilities, allowing RPA tools to work seamlessly with existing software solutions. Companies report significant time savings of up to 80% in task completion through these innovations.

Integration with artificial intelligence is becoming more prevalent. RPA solutions can now handle complex decision-making processes by analyzing data patterns and adjusting operations accordingly. Businesses that leverage these advanced features often experience improved accuracy and reduced error rates.

Cloud-based RPA has gained traction. This shift enables organizations to deploy RPA solutions faster and scale operations with ease. Accessing RPA tools in a cloud environment allows for collaboration across teams, fostering a more interconnected work culture.

Security enhancements are also a key focus. RPA providers are implementing stricter protocols to protect sensitive data and maintain compliance with industry regulations. Organizations adopting these updates benefit from reduced risks associated with automation processes.

User-friendly interfaces are a priority in the latest RPA updates. New platforms prioritize usability, enabling employees with minimal technical background to automate processes effectively. The focus on user experience facilitates wider adoption within organizations, empowering more team members to take advantage of RPA capabilities.

Increased Adoption In Various Industries

Increased RPA adoption is evident across finance, healthcare, and manufacturing sectors. Organizations in finance benefit from automation streamlining tasks like transaction processing and compliance reporting. Healthcare facilities automate patient data management, enhancing service delivery and reducing errors. Manufacturing industries reduce labor costs by automating inventory management and production scheduling. Businesses can achieve time savings of up to 80%, making automation a strategic priority. Rising interest from small and medium enterprises indicates that RPA is no longer exclusive to large corporations. Emerging Technologies Enhancing Automation

Emerging technologies play a crucial role in enhancing RPA capabilities. Artificial intelligence integration allows RPA systems to tackle complex decision-making tasks effectively. Natural language processing enables smoother interactions between bots and users, fostering more intuitive automation solutions. Machine learning algorithms improve RPA tools by analyzing data patterns, leading to better predictions and outcomes. The development of low-code platforms simplifies automation adoption for users with minimal technical skills. Cloud-based RPA deployments also support scalability, allowing organizations to adjust resources according to their needs. Integration With Legacy Systems

Integrating RPA with legacy systems poses significant issues for many organizations. Legacy systems often lack compatibility with modern automation tools, complicating the integration process. Data migration becomes a critical factor, as organizations must ensure seamless data flow between old and new systems. Up to 50% of businesses experience disruptions during this transition. Collaboration between IT and business units is essential to overcome these obstacles. Focusing on comprehensive assessments of existing systems helps in identifying potential integration hurdles before deployment. Continuous support from vendors can further ease this transition, promoting a smoother incorporation of RPA.

Addressing Security Concerns

Security concerns remain a top priority as RPA adoption increases. Organizations must safeguard sensitive data against breaches and unauthorized access effectively. Implementing robust security protocols can mitigate risks inherent in automation processes. Studies show that 60% of firms view RPA security as a major challenge. Regular audits and compliance checks enhance the security framework within automated environments. Employing encryption and multi-factor authentication can also bolster data protection measures. Ensuring that employees receive adequate training on security best practices promotes an organization-wide culture of security awareness.
